Least Common Multiple of 47662 and 47678 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 47662 and 47678,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(47662,47678) = 2
LCM(47662,47678) = ( 47662 × 47678) / 2
LCM(47662,47678) = 2272428836 / 2
LCM(47662,47678) = 1136214418
